Key Features to Consider When Choosing Display Racks for Retail

When choosing display racks for retail, it’s essential to focus on functionality. Whether for groceries or electronics, the right rack must accommodate the products effectively. Adjustable shelves allow for flexibility, making them suitable for varying product sizes. Clear labeling is also critical. This ensures customers can find what they need quickly. Heavy-duty options are crucial for larger items. Sturdiness can prevent accidents and protect your investment.

Aesthetics play an essential role as well. The design of the display can influence customer perception. Sleek and modern designs can attract more attention. However, the color and material should align with the brand’s identity. Sustainability is a growing concern. Eco-friendly materials are becoming increasingly popular among buyers. However, not all racks claim to be eco-conscious, so research is vital.

Another aspect to reflect on is the rack’s space efficiency. Will it fit well in your retail environment? Overcrowding can detract from the shopping experience. It’s a delicate balance. Additionally, consider the ease of assembly. Some racks may require professional installation, leading to extra costs. While you may save upfront, hidden expenses can accumulate. Always weigh immediate benefits against long-term value.

Top 10 Shelf Display Racks for Global Buyers in 2026

Rank Type Material Height (cm) Load Capacity (kg) Price Range (USD)
1 Gondola Rack Steel 180 150 $150 - $300
2 Wall Shelf Wood 90 50 $50 - $150
3 Display Stand Plastic 120 30 $20 - $60
4 Corner Rack Metal 150 100 $80 - $200
5 Slatwall Shelf Chipboard 100 40 $30 - $90
6 Freestanding Rack Aluminum 200 120 $200 - $400
7 Hanging Shelf Glass 80 25 $70 - $150
8 Portable Rack Fabric 100 20 $40 - $80
9 Bakery Display Wood 120 60 $150 - $300
10 Checkout Stand Steel 90 70 $100 - $250
